"Revolutionary AI-Powered Drone Detection System Unveiled for Critical Infrastructure Protection"
In a groundbreaking development, Czech startup Neuron Soundware has unveiled Sound Shield, a cutting-edge AI-powered acoustic detection system designed to safeguard critical infrastructure from the growing threat of drones. This innovative solution identifies drones by analyzing the unique sound patterns generated by their engines, utilizing cost-effective microphone sensors priced between €100 and €150 each.
At the heart of Sound Shield lies a sophisticated AI-driven algorithm that processes data from an array of microphones to detect and identify drones with high accuracy. This passive, low-cost system is poised to revolutionize the way critical infrastructure, such as airports, power plants, and government facilities, is protected against drone-related threats. By leveraging sound waves, Sound Shield offers a non-intrusive and energy-efficient solution that can be seamlessly integrated into existing security frameworks.
